In the heart of China, a cultural phenomenon is rekindling interest in traditional attire—the art of Hanfu, a garment that embodies the essence of ancient Chinese culture. Among the latest trends in this ancient fashion, little girls are now donning the enchanting Xiaochao Xian-style Hanfu costumes, embodying a charming blend of antiquity and modernity.
The summer season is an ideal time for these little ones to showcase their elegant attire. The light and breathable materials used in Hanfu designs make them perfect for the warm weather. The Xiaochao Xian style, which means "little fairy" in Chinese, embodies a charming and whimsical essence that captures the imagination of both children and adults.
The design of these Hanfu costumes is intricate and rich in cultural significance. The vibrant colors and intricate patterns are not just for aesthetics but also symbolize various aspects of Chinese culture and traditions. The use of traditional Chinese knots, embroidery, and other embellishments add to the elegance and beauty of these costumes.

The trend of wearing Hanfu costumes has also sparked interest in various cultural activities. Children now participate in events like tea ceremonies, traditional dance performances, and cultural festivals where they wear these costumes. These activities help them understand the rich history and traditions associated with Hanfu and appreciate the beauty of their own culture.
Moreover, these Hanfu costumes are not just for special occasions but are also becoming a part of daily fashion. Little girls are now wearing them to school, to the park, or even for casual outings. This trend shows that children are embracing their culture and are proud to represent it.
The popularity of Hanfu costumes has also led to the emergence of various online communities and forums where people share their experiences, ideas, and designs. These communities provide a platform for people to learn more about Hanfu culture and share their passion for this ancient fashion.
